WebYou should get tested for COVID-19 if: you have symptoms of the illness — even if your symptoms are mild; or 35 days have passed since you had a positive COVID-19 test … Web15 feb. 2024 · After you arrive in the U.S., the CDC recommends getting tested with a viral test 3 to 5 days after your trip. If you're traveling to the U.S. and you aren't a citizen, you need to be fully vaccinated and have proof of vaccination. You don't need to quarantine when you arrive in the U.S. But check for any symptoms.
